Set Up
Attach the front wheel
Orient the front wheel and align it to
the fork. While both bikes front wheels
are non directional, the 16“ wheel has
an asymmetrical design feature to take
a brake rotor. The illustration is showing
it on the same side of the rear brake
Use a 15mm wrench to tighten the axle
bolts to 12.5 ft lbs (IMPORTANT- DO
NOT OVER-TIGHTEN)

Install the handlebar
Unscrew and take off the handlebar
cover. Center the handlebar onto the
stem, the brake lever should be in posi-
tion to be operated by the left hand
Use a 4mm Allen wrench to fasten the
four screws halfway, rotate the handle
bar to achieve the right t
Tighten the screws all the way to 3.75 ft
lbs to secure the handlebar in place
(IMPORTANT- DO NOT OVER-TIGHTEN)
